REDUCE is a simple computer algebra system which enables users to manipulate complex algebraic expressions and equations symbolically, as mathematicians and scientists do traditionally on paper. Its capabilities include differentiation and exact symbolic integration. This book provides a comprehensive introduction to REDUCE, including some of the user-contributed REDUCE packages written for specific applications. The authors' aim is to enable all students using REDUCE for the first time to gain a familiarity with the full range of REDUCE commands whilst at the same time learning something of its internal workings. Throughout, numerous exercises are provided to illustrate themes covered in the text as well as to encourage "hands on" practice.
REDUCE is a simple computer algebra system which enables users to manipulate complex algebraic expressions and equations symbolically, as mathematicians and scientists do traditionally on paper. Its capabilities include differentiation and exact symbolic integration. This book provides a comprehensive introduction to REDUCE, including some of the user-contributed REDUCE packages written for specific applications. The authors' aim is to enable all students using REDUCE for the first time to gain a familiarity with the full range of REDUCE commands whilst at the same time learning something of its internal workings. Throughout, numerous exercises are provided to illustrate themes covered in the text as well as to encourage "hands on" practice.
REDUCE as an algebraic calculator; Controlling REDUCE: operators and matrices; REDUCE as an algebraic programming language; Algebraic procedures, operators and algorithms; A look inside REDUCE; Programming in (R) Lisp; Factorization and integration in REDUCE; The user-contributed REDUCE packages; Advanced topics; Appendix.
`This book provides a comprehensive introduction to REDUCE.
'
L'Enseignement Mathématique, 1992
`This is a well-constructed complement to the REDUCE user's manual,
with a lot of background material as well as advanced examples ...
it will prove useful to all serious users of the REDUCE system.
'
Dr A.H. Harker, AEA, Harwell, Contemporary Physics, Volume 33,
Number 2, March/April 1992
`If REDUCE is the system that you're using, then this is an
excellent complement both to the system manual and to Gerald
Rayna's REDUCE: software for algebraic computation.
'
Times Higher Educational Supplement
`...one of the best introductions to REDUCE available....the
exercises included at the end of each chapter deserve special
mention and have to be considered as one of the most original
contributions of the book. They illustrate interesting applications
of computer algebra in mathematical physics ranging from standard
exercises oriented to develop skills using the package, to
non-trivial problems intended to stimulate reflection on the
particular point
involved.'
General Relativity and Gravitation, Vol. 27, No. 4, 1995
![]() |
Ask a Question About this Product More... |
![]() |